The Act 16 preview is up on a reasonable day this week at the official Live Action Sailor Moon page. Most of the weekly diaries are also on time as well, so I plan to have them all for you in one shot tomorrow.

One of the Dark Kingdom's Shitennou, Kunzite, and his youma, are beginning to scheme again. Recent 'disappearance' incidents were caused by his powers. And Rei and Makoto have made sure of this. Yet, that while the two of them were fighting youma, Usagi was spending time with Mamoru, is something she can't talk to them about...

Meanwhile, at school, Ami and Naru fall ill at ease with each other over their relationship with Usagi. Sharp language from Naru wounds Ami deeply. Afterwards, by chance, Ami sees Naru on the same street. Just as Ami is thinking to slip away, a hole suddenly appears in the earth under Naru, who slides in!

I write "relationship with" to make the sentence flow better, but the term used in the original is megutte which means circling or 'patrolling.' So basically, as they're doting on her, things aren't working out right.

The Toei page has the following notes:

With difficulty the youma was exorcised from Sailor Moon. Yet unbeknownst to her, Kunzite's "Energy Farm" battle plan has actually been advancing. Right in front of Ami's eyes, Naru is caught in one of his traps...

The youma brought Edea to mind for some reason.

As the 'good atmosphere' between Usagi and Mamoru begins to blossom, Kunzite's plan nears completion. It's going to be a big problem!

"Good atmosphere" is the literal translation of the term they use. The HICBC previews also like to use the good/bad 'atmosphere' metaphor in gauging relationships; that they used a different one for their reference to Ami and Naru was almost surprising as they seem fond of writing that specific term every week. (The atmosphere between Usagi and Mamoru is bad, the atmosphere between Rei and Makoto is bad, etc.) The previews don't really flow well in the original language; they're intentionally stilted, and often use hackneyed and trite language. One of the HICBC favourites is sonna toki [at that time or at the same time] and it's a rare update indeed that doesn't have that precise phrase in the text.
